As of this writing, some of you might already have gotten the TraceTogether token during the first phase of the distribution. Good news is that they have added 18 more CCs and Mobile Booths to let you collect it.

According to the schedule, the September to October period is for these areas.
- Ang Mo Kio, Bishan, Toa Payoh
- Aljunied, Bedok, East Coast, Hougang, Marine Parade,
- Sengkang, Tampines
In total, there are now 38 CCs that you can visit to collect the token. Use this website to check the nearest one from your home.

BTW, if you have the TraceTogether token, you can use it to scan the entry to the place.
Here is a list of venues where visitors can check in by scanning their TraceTogether Tokens:
Supermarkets |
FairPrice |
Sheng Siong |
Malls* |
Bedok Mall |
Bugis Junction |
Bugis Plus |
Bukit Panjang Plaza |
Causeway Point |
Capitol Plaza |
Chijmes |
Clarke Quay Central |
IMM |
Jewel Changi Airport |
Junction 8 |
Jcube |
Marina @ Keppel Bay |
Marina Bay Sands Casino/Hotel/Mall |
NEX |
Northpoint City |
Plaza Singapura |
SingPost Centre |
Tampines Mall |
Lot One |
The Star Vista |
Westgate |
Funan Mall |
Raffles City Shopping Centre |
Vivocity |
*SafeEntry check-in with TraceTogether Tokens may not be available at all venues within the mall.
